Publisher's Synopsis

-Do you feel powerless; not only against the world but also against yourself? -Are you paralysed with anxiety, despair or depression in which your authentic self seems but a fleeting hint of memories past? -What does it mean to truly come alive? -Are you so concerned with evil that you forget to live? The Power of Childhood goes to the heart of the power of childhood to address these dilemmas. As we discover the seeds of bliss and joy that seem obscured by the phantom of darkness of the ego we will find that the unconditional love that emerges is the greatest gift we will ever be able to give our own children ... ------------------------ When you do what you don't want to do and don't do what you want to, it's not the devil, and it's not sin. It's childhood consciousness, thwarted. We come into the world in a state of love. To the extent that our natural expectations are met we become confident and happy. To the extent that they are not, we develop a protective shield of fear around us that becomes our self-sabotaging false identity or ego. None of us is without this. We don't have rational access to the powerful source of our pain. Only by deeply experiencing our pain can we transcend it. In so doing we develop a deep strength and understanding that enables us to forgive, and thereby come to experience the Love that we truly are.
